Laos was amazing we got a bus upto the boarder crossing and then stayed in these huts overnight before crossing the boarder the next day. At the huts we met a really good group of people and all got drunk at this time curfew was in and we had to be back at 9pm so had to run to a 7/11 shop and grab some drink.


Then the next day we crossed the boarder which was quite simple and got on the slow boat down the Mekong river. The boat journey took about 7 hours to Prabang. The scenery was stunning never seen anything like it and just sat chatting to people and had some beers so didnt really mind being sat on a wooden bench for 7 hours lol. Then at Prabang we stayed there for the night. Went in the river swimming just as the sun was setting which was amazing swimming about in the Mekong with all the stunning scenery about!


The next day we got back on the slow boat early and this time wasn't as many seats so had to sit on the floor at the back of the boat by the engine! I used this time to read my book then sat on the edge of the boat for a bit and then played some cards.


The boat journey took about 7 hours again and then we arrive at Luang Prabang. The next day (feeling hanging from the night before) we got the bus to Vang Vieng the which was a horrible 7 hour journey feeling cramped in a little mini bus. We booked into a hotel called pans place. The next day it was tubing time got to the river at about 12pm and me and Hazel decided that we didnt need tubes and Kerry and Phillip did get tubes. Went to the first bar had a few vodka and cokes while watching people swing of the big swing into the river i was too scared to do it at this point.

Later on i did the smaller swing which was really fun then got really drunk and tried to swim down the river and cut my knees open then got in Kerrys ring with her.

We were in Vang Vieng for 9 days one day we relaxed by the pool another day we went on a bike ride through all these Laos villages to the blue lagoon which was really good.
